Pay it forward
It’s 7am and an elderly lady rolled up to the Starbucks drive-thru window on Tyrone Blvd (St Petersburg). She decided to pay for the person’s coffee behind her. The elated driver behind her, decided to do the same thing for the person behind them. This random act of kindness called “Paying it forward” , went on for 11 hours and served 378 consecutive cars. One bad decision
A switch hitter , the all-time leader in hits (4,256), games played (3,562), at-bats (14,053), singles (3,215), and outs (10,328). He won Rookie of the Year. three World Series , three batting titles , (1) MVP and (2) Gold Gloves (as an outfielder). He made 17 All-Star appearances at an unequaled five positions.
